✅ The Legal Answer
It depends! 🤷♂️ Recording a call is NOT illegal, but its usage can be! The Indian legal framework covers:
🏛️ When Is Call Recording LEGAL?
✔️ Self-recording – If you’re part of the conversation 🎙️✅
✔️ For personal reference – As long as it’s not misused 📝🔍
✔️ With prior consent – If both parties agree to the recording 🤝📑

🚨 When Can It Get You in TROUBLE?
✔️ If used for blackmail or harassment ❌🚨
✔️ If leaked publicly without consent 📢⚖️
✔️ If recorded by a third party without legal permission 🔍📞
✔️ If it violates data protection laws (once enacted in India) 🛑💻

💡 Pro Tip: How to Use Call Recordings Legally?
✔️ Use only for legal evidence, not revenge! ⚖️🔎
✔️ Inform the other party if recording for transparency 📢✅
✔️ If using in court, ensure it follows evidence laws 🏛️📜
✔️ Avoid sharing on social media—it can backfire legally! 🚫📲
